Description | MKC-1 (Ro-31-7453) is an orally bioavailable, small-molecule, bisindolylmaleimide cell cycle inhibitor with potential antineoplastic activity. MKC-1 and its metabolites inhibit tubulin polymerization, blocking the formation of the mitotic spindle, which may result in |
Synonyms | Ro-31-7453 |
Molecular Weight | 400.39 |
Formula | C22H16N4O4 |
CAS No. | 125313-92-0 |
Powder: -20°C for 3 years | In solvent: -80°C for 1 year
DMSO: 55 mg/mL (137.36 mM)
